Q. Which Indian airline recently inducted India's first Airbus A350 aircraft into its fleet?
Answer: Air India
Notes: Air India, the former national carrier now owned by India's largest conglomerate Tata Group, has become the first Indian airline to incorporate an Airbus A350 aircraft. The technologically advanced wide-body plane landed in India on 24th December, heralding Air India's plans to connect India with more long haul international routes.
